This summer, the Flames made a change to their Assistant GM ranks, as well as multiple changes to their coaching staff in both the NHL and AHL levels. The Flames also added to their development, scouting, and data\/analytics departments. Let\u2019s detail the changes to the Flames organization below.<\/p>\n<p>Promotions \/ Role Changes<\/p>\n<p>Peter Hanlon \u2013 Hanlon was promoted to Assistant General Manager after previously serving as the Vice President of Communications with the Flames, a role he\u2019s held since the 1997\u201398 season.<\/p>\n<p>Sean Kelso \u2013 In a subsequent move, Kelso was promoted to Vice President of Communications. Kelso was previously the Director of Media Relations with the club.<\/p>\n<p>Trent Cull \u2013 Cull has been promoted to assistant coach with the Flames. He began as <a href=\"https:\/\/thewincolumn.ca\/2023\/07\/18\/everything-you-need-to-know-about-the-calgary-wranglers-naming-trent-cull-as-their-new-head-coach\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">the Head Coach of the Calgary Wranglers for the 2023\u201324 season<\/a> before becoming an Interim Assistant Coach with the Flames following Brad Larsen\u2019s departure for family reasons.<\/p>\n<p>Brett Sutter \u2013 Sutter has been promoted to head coach of the Calgary Wranglers. He served as an assistant coach with the Calgary Wranglers last season. Sutter was the captain of the Calgary Wranglers in the 2022\u201323 and 2023\u201324 seasons.<\/p>\n<p>Matt Stajan \u2013 Stajan joined the Flames and Wranglers last season as a skills consultant. He was previously an assistant coach with the Calgary Hitmen. The former Flame played nine seasons with the team. <\/p>\n<p>Alex Robson \u2013 Robson was promoted to Director of Engineering, Hockey Analytics. Robson was previously a Data Engineer. <\/p>\n<p>Individuals who have joined the organization<\/p>\n<p>Dave Lowry \u2013 Lowry joined the Flames as an Assistant Coach a few weeks ago, following Brad Larsen\u2019s departure. Calgary is a familiar spot for Lowry. He captained the Flames in the early 2000s as a player. After he finished his NHL career, Lowry joined the Calgary Hitmen as an assistant coach. He would then move into the head coaching role of the Hitmen, and then move to be an assistant with the Flames. After subsequent stops with the Victoria Royals, the Los Angeles Kings, Brandon Wheat Kings, Winnipeg Jets, and, most recently, the Seattle Kraken, Lowry returns to Calgary.<\/p>\n<p>Brent Seabrook \u2013 The three-time Stanley Cup champion joined the Flames as part of the Player Development staff. He started working with the Flames ahead of development camp, where he was working with the defensive prospects. Alongside Michael Stone, the team now has two former NHL defencemen working in player development.<\/p>\n<p>Joby Messier \u2013 Messier joined the Flames organization in-season. He\u2019s focused on the NCAA. Messier previously served as an Amateur Scout with the Carolina Hurricanes from 2018\u201319 through the 2020\u201321 seasons.<\/p>\n<p>Etienne Rouleau \u2013 Rouleau joined the organization this past season as a Data Analyst in their Data\/Analytics department. Previously, Rouleau was a Scout &amp; Coordinator with the University of Moncton in USports from the 2017\u201318 thru the 2021\u201322 seasons. He  also served as a Scout &amp; Analytics Coordinator with the Rouyn-Noranda Huskies in the QMJHL in the 2018\u201319 and 2019\u201320 seasons. Rouleau then moved on to the Moncton Wildcats of the QMJHL as a Scout &amp; Analytics Coordinator from the 2020\u201321 to the 2023\u201324 season, before being promoted as the Director of Analytics with the Wildcats in 2024\u201325.<\/p>\n<p>Individuals who have left the organization<\/p>\n<p>Dan Lambert \u2013 Lambert was released from the final year of his contract as an assistant coach following the promotion of Trent Cull. <\/p>\n<p>Brad Larsen \u2013 Larsen joined the Flames as an assistant coach before the 2024\u201325 season. Larsen left the club midway through the season to deal with a family matter. The Flames announced that Larsen would not be returning to the bench.
